Paul Scholes has revealed the two key players he expects Manchester United to offload this summer to raise funds for new signings.

Manchester United’s performance this season has been a major disappointment, with the club desperate to get back on track under Ruben Amorim. 

The Portuguese boss says changes are needed but also acknowledges the financial constraints the club are facing. Which could make it particularly difficult to attract top players. Amorim’s initial transfer budget is expected to be modest, unless sales bring in additional funds. 

This reality can lead to difficult decisions, especially when it comes to releasing players, especially those coming out of academies who are valued in the market.

Manchester United legend Paul Scholes said: “It must be a big concern. It doesn’t look like Ruben Amorim is getting a lot of money to play on the pitch. It doesn’t feel like that at all.”

“I feel like I could be wrong, but I think they might sell two young players. I think they might sell Kobbie Menou and Alejandro Garnacho. Maybe the club will sell them this summer.” 

“Selling Menu would be damaging, they could do both. Garnacho came later but Menu has been at the club since he was a kid. He did brilliantly last year and it makes the academy look bad if a player like him doesn’t do that and they have to sell him. I hope I’m wrong, I hope they don’t do that, but the noise I’m hearing is very worrying.”
